1. Commiphora Mukul Resin

Sourced from the sap of Commiphora mukul tree (native to India), commiphora mukul resin is very well known for its cholesterol and triglyceride lowering properties. More known as guggul extract, this compound contains active chemicals that can help burn fat by correcting lipid disorders and controlling obesity. Gugul can also help elevate the concentration of high-density lipoprotein (good cholesterol in the blood).

2. Glycyrrhiza Glabra

Glycyrrhiza glabra or more known as licorice, is a plant that is known to have beneficial health effects. The chemicals in glycyrrhiza glabra is known to reduce swelling, thin mucus secretions, cough, and heal ulcers.

But did you know that licorice is also a good fat buster? Yes, flavonoids in this plant extract can inhibit oxidation of fatty acids. This plant also helps regulate triglyceride levels in your liver and blood.

3. Vrikshamla

Vrikshamla is a very popular fruit extract that is now making headlines worldwide due to its touted weight loss power. More known as garcinia cambogia, this fruit extract is packed with potent chemical called hydroxycitric acid (HCA).

This hydroxycitric acid helps inhibit fat accumulation that prevents your body to put on pounds. Garcinia cambogia is also known to help trigger satiety, which means that it can help suppress your appetite for more weight loss.

4. Nigella Sativa

Nigella sativa is a plant known as the kalonji in the Indian subcontinent. In some areas of the world, this herb is called black seed.

Ayurvedic practitioners recommends nigella sative because they believe in its weight loss power. The anti-obesity effect of black seed has been proven by some clinical laboratory tests to help reduce body mass index and waist-hip ratios.

Black seed is also known to help treat toothache, headache, nasal congestion, asthma, bronchitis, allergies, constipation and many others.

5. Zingiber Officinale

Zingiber officinale or more known simply as ginger, is a herb (rhizome) that is commonly used as a spice and as an ingredient in most medicinal drugs.

This herb contains chemicals that may reduce nausea and inflammation. These chemicals works primarily in the stomach and intestines, but they may also influence your brain and nervous system to help control nausea, dizziness and headache.

Ginger may assist in weight loss by utilizing its phytochemicals. These chemicals help regulate metabolism of cholesterol and oxidation of fatty acids, which results to fat storage inhibition and much lower blood cholesterol levels.
